The "special compensation" compromise on concurrent receipt (January Washington Wire) left hundreds of thousands of disabled military retirees still sacrificing portions of their retirement pay because of a 111-year-old law. Add to that list veterans exposed to Agent Orange.

Though the compromise grants compensation to retirees with a 60% or greater disability resulting from, among other things, an "instrumentality of war," apparently that doesn't cover Agent Orange exposure. VA lists 10 ailments that it considers were caused by exposure to the herbicide.
